Peter Hirsch

Peter Hirsch is a German painter, graphic artist and draftsman as a child private lessons in painting, apprenticeship as a lithographer, studied at the Munich Academy. He loaded exhibitions in the Munich Glass Palace and in the Kunstverein, ostracized as "degenerate" in Germany 1933-45 partly active in the USA, Canada, the Netherlands, Italy, England, France, Hungary and Switzerland, from 1944 temporarily relocated to the Schliersee, before 1930 -1969 lecturer at the Munich Adult Education Center.

Date and place of birt:24 august 1889, Munich, Germany
Date and place of death:26 june 1978, Munich, Germany
Period of activity: XX century
Specialization:Artist, Draftsman, Graphic artist, Landscape painter, Painter, Portraitist
Genre:Cityscape, Mountain landscape, Landscape painting, Portrait, Self-portrait
Art style:Degenerate art, Expressionism, Modern art, Post War Art
